In Merthyr Tydfil, 8,662 rated homes sit below EPC band C. That puts the area at #180 for the widest gap among local authority areas in England & Wales.

Direction of travel

On current pace, reaches band C by 2044

Projection from the 15-year rated-stock trend; not a forecast.

Retrofit gap

48.7%

of 17,789 rated domestic dwellings are below band C.

C+ sale-price premium — size/type/location controlled

+41.6%
Homes rated C or better sell for ~+41.6% more per m², holding size, type and location constant (95% CI +41.6%+41.6%).

Local context

Fuel poverty & deprivation here

WIMD provides current local deprivation context. The latest Welsh fuel-poverty estimate is national only, so no local percentage is inferred for this authority.

Neighbourhoods in the most-deprived 10%

17.0%

share of LSOAs in the most-deprived national decile · Welsh Index of Multiple Deprivation 2025.
